The TUDORBlack Bay GMT M79833MN-0001 stands out with its dual-time capabilities and sophisticated design, the combination of stainless steel and yellow gold offers a refined contrast that exudes timeless elegance.
-
Case: 41mm steel case with polished and satin finish
-
Bezel: 48-notch bidirectional rotating bezel with a steel core, covered by a 0.3mm yellow gold cap. 24-hour graduated matt brown and black anodised aluminium disc
-
Movement: Manufacture Calibre MT5652 (COSC) Self-winding mechanical movement with bidirectional rotor system Built-in architecture
-
Power Reserve: Approximately 70 hours
-
Dial: Black, Domed
-
Winding Crown: Screw-down winding crown, with the TUDOR rose engraved and lacquered in black, with black anodised aluminium winding crown tube. Steel covered by a 0.3mm yellow gold cap
-
Crystal: Domed sapphire crystal
-
Water Resistance: Waterproof to 200m (660 ft)
-
Strap: First center links at 6 and 12 oclock in solid yellow gold. Remaining center links in steel or steel covered by a 0.2mm yellow gold cap. Folding clasp and safety catch
Black Bay
The Black Bay celebrates 60 years of diving watches with extraordinary heritage. The iconic model inherits the general lines, as well as the domed dial and crystal from the first TUDOR diving watches. It borrows the characteristic angular hands, known as snowflake, from the watches delivered in large quantities to the French National Navy in the 1970s. Black Bay GMT
The Black Bay GMT is an extension of the Black Bay line with a highly functional complication: a multiple time-zone function also known as a GMT function. Recognisable by its rotatable bezel, which derives its deep blue and burgundy colour theme from other models in the Black Bay line, but in a matte version, the Black Bay GMT is also a nod to the early days of this watchmaking function..
Discover TUDOR
TUDOR is a Swiss-made watch brand, offering mechanical watches with sophisticated style and proven reliability. The origins of TUDOR date back to 1926, when “The TUDOR” was first registered as a brand on behalf of Rolex founder, Hans Wilsdorf. Throughout their history, TUDOR watches have been chosen by the boldest adventurers and seasoned professionals alike.
